Performance Issues
Our Production MOSS 2007 environment has been experiencing performance issues throughout most of the morning. How could I do a high level check to see if we are seeing any evidence of a performance
issue on the web/app and/or database tiers.

You can use perfmon and use its counters to monitor the health of the process, for ASP.NET you can use the following counters to measure the performance of a web app. This
MSDN article will be helpful in monitoring the health using Perfmon
ASP.NET\ Requests Queued
ASP.NET Applications\ Requests In Application Queue
ASP.NET\ Requests Rejected
ASP.NET\ Requests Wait Time
ASP.NET\Requests Current
ASP.NET Applications\Requests Executing
ASP.NET Applications\ Requests Timed Out
for a Web Farm wide health monitoring, you should use Microsoft System Center operations manager along with the
Management Pack.Aravind http://aravindrises.blogspot.com
